I use levemir and the pens are "supposed" to be good for 42 days. That's for a human that it is carrying it around in their pocket unrefrigerated.
Lately, I have gotten just about every drop out of my pens as well. The one thing I found that does affect it is the amount of time you leave it out of the frig while you are drawing the dose as the pen gets to the last 40-50 units. I did some reading on this and, apparently, as the pen gets down closer to the bottom and less volume, the change in temp from in/out of the frig and sitting out, can affect the insulin more by making it just a little less effective. So you might start to see numbers get a little wonky. For that reason, I take the pen out, draw the dose out of it and immediately put the pen back in the frig before I adjust my dose in the syringe. I never leave the pen on the counter while I'm adjusting the dose. Also...it's best to keep them in a cheese drawer...or some other kind of drawer where they are less affected by temp changes as you open and close the frig door. I also keep a refrigerator thermometer in next to my pack of pens. I have found that if I put warm food from a pan into a container and put it in the frig while warm, it actually raises the temp in the cheese drawer...especially if we are having a party and I have alot of food. I usually put all warm food in the other frig to keep from affecting the temperature.

Under the protocol, if an attempted reduction fails, go right back up to the last good dose. What you want to see after you reduce is when she clears the bounces, she comes back into green. Because a higher dose can affect up to six subsequent cycles (although most cats it's likely 3-4) it's usually worthwhile to hold the reduced dose for at least four cycles and let the depot drain before you decide whether the dose reduction held or not. If you see green numbers in the first four cycles after the reduction, you could still be seeing depot from the higher dose. You can always ask us until you get comfortable with seeing it on her SS.
